Step-by-Step Installation Guide
Step 1: Measure and Cut
Place the smart screen over your gutter. Measure and mark the length you need. Use tin snips to cut the guard to size. Hhalum guards are made from roll-forming aluminum sheets or extruded profiles, which makes them easy to cut cleanly.
Step 2: Secure with Clips
Slide the special aluminum clips under the bottom row of your shingles. These clips hold the guard firmly in place without damaging your roof. This smart design makes installation quick, whether you’re doing it yourself or working on a big project.
Step 3: Check the Water Flow
Once a section is installed, use a garden hose to run water over it. Watch how the water flows through the guard and into the gutter. The smart screen is designed to let water through while blocking leaves and other debris.

How do the heated guards work with the aluminum screens?
The heating cables sit under the aluminum screen. When it’s cold, they warm up just enough to melt snow and ice, letting water flow through the gutter system instead of freezing.
